Certified Wired for Reading is a research-based literacy program designed to help students develop strong foundational reading skills through structured, systematic instruction. The program focuses on phonics, fluency, comprehension, and vocabulary in a way that's tailored to each student's reading level and learning style. Tutors trained in this approach use evidence-based techniques to help students build confidence and competency as readers.

Certified Wired for Reading is primarily designed for elementary and early middle school students who are building or strengthening their foundational reading skills. However, the program can be adapted for older students who need intervention in phonics, decoding, or fluency. A tutor trained in Certified Wired for Reading can assess your student's current reading level and determine whether this approach is the right fit for their needs.

During the first session, a tutor will typically conduct a reading assessment to understand your student's current skills, challenges, and learning style. They'll ask questions about reading history, identify specific areas where your student struggles, and explain how the Certified Wired for Reading approach works. This foundation helps the tutor create a personalized plan and set realistic goals for improvement.

Certified Wired for Reading tutors work with students who struggle with phonics and decoding, have difficulty with fluency or reading speed, struggle to comprehend what they read, or have limited vocabulary. Many students also benefit from the program if they've fallen behind grade-level expectations or have been identified with dyslexia or other reading differences. The structured, systematic approach helps address these challenges at their root.

A qualified tutor will regularly assess your student's reading skills using tools like fluency checks, comprehension assessments, and phonics inventories to measure growth over time. You should expect clear communication about what your student is learning, specific areas of improvement, and realistic timelines for progress. Most students show measurable gains in fluency and comprehension within a few weeks of consistent, personalized instruction.
